Asset Manager

Position Description


The Asset Manager will be responsible for actively managing a portfolio of office assets to develop strategy, optimize cash flow, and enhance value.

  • Develop and implement strategic business plans for each asset that will govern its daily operations, position in the market, and ultimate disposition
  • Direct and steer Property Management team to assure financial performance, timely reporting, proactive and high-quality repairs and maintenance, and positive tenant relations
  • Model full life cycle of each asset from acquisition through disposition including investor returns under different scenarios
  • Assist with disposition and refinancing efforts through broker solicitation and selection, negotiation of legal agreements, and closing
  • Assist with conducting transaction analysis and support due diligence for new acquisitions 


Financial Analysis, Oversight, and Investor Reporting


  • Lead the annual budget, business planning, and reforecasting process for each asset
  • Review monthly property management reports for variance against budget and strategy
  • Prepare monthly, quarterly, and annual reporting for investor clients and senior leadership
  • Create cash flow projections, analyze and recommend investor capital calls and distributions
  • Perform Argus valuations of each asset on a bi-annual basis
  • Review third-party appraisals for accuracy and consistency
  • Develop analytical tools to allow leadership to better understand the state of the portfolio
  • Monitor and maintain compliance with all lender requirements
  • Monitor timely payment of taxes and insurance premiums
  • Monitor all escrow accounts and operating cash accounts to assure they are properly funded
  • Review property manager operating expense and CAM reconciliations for accuracy, and provide final approvals to PMs prior to sending out tenant letters
  • Collaborate with other departments to improve and document processes and streamline reporting


Leasing


  • Manage relationships with leasing brokers, attorneys, and lenders to negotiate lease terms at or above proforma budget
  • Review LOI’s and leasing documents
  • Draft landlord work letters for leases to be approved by owner
  • Review outside broker listing agreements
  • Track ROFO’s and ROFR’s of existing tenants
  • Work closely with property managers to transition new tenants into properties


R&M and Capital Improvements


  • Forecast repair and maintenance budgets and oversee property management to implement a proactive and high-quality maintenance plan
  • Develop capital improvement strategies, to be approved by owner, and oversee design and construction management activities
  • Monitor construction progress and ensure TI and CapEx projects are closed out
  • Negotiate third-party contracts and oversee implementation of capital improvement and “value-add” programs within the portfolio
